Bosnian Serb Republic eight-month production
The Statistical Office of the Bosnian Serb Republic reports that the production of leather and leather products in the Republic in the first eight months of this year was 9% lower than in the same period in 2007.
In comparison, industrial output in the Bosnian Serb Republic in the January to August period this year was 8.4% higher year-on-year.
Production of leather and leather products in September was 3.3% lower than in August and 0.2% per cent lower than in September 2007. In comparison, industrial output in Bosnia and Herzegovina in September was 2.9% higher month-on-month and 14.9% higher year-on-year.
The number of people employed in the Republic's leather industry in the first seven months of this year was 8.5% higher than in the same period in 2007. The average net monthly wage in the Bosnian leather industry in August was US$281, a decrease of 2.4% compared with July. In comparison, the average net monthly wage in Bosnia and Herzegovina in August was US$530.
